PLSQL创建表空间的方法
在PL/SQL中,创建表空间的基本语法如下:
CREATE TABLESPACE tablespace_name
DATAFILE 'datafile_path_size' SIZE datafile_size
[AUTOEXTEND ON NEXT datafile_size_increment
[MAXSIZE datafile_max_size]]
[LOGGING | NOLOGGING];
其中:
tablespace_name
是您要创建的表空间的名称。datafile_path_size
是数据文件的路径和名称。datafile_size
是数据文件的初始大小。AUTOEXTEND ON
和NEXT
子句用于指示自动扩展特性,datafile_size_increment
是每次自动扩展的大小。MAXSIZE
子句用于指定数据文件可以自动扩展到的最大尺寸。LOGGING
和NOLOGGING
用于指定表空间是否使用日志模式。
下面是一个创建表空间的示例代码:
CREATE TABLESPACE users
DATAFILE '/u01/oradata/dbname/users01.dbf' SIZE 100M
AUTOEXTEND ON NEXT 10M MAXSIZE UNLIMITED
LOGGING;
这个例子创建了一个名为 users
的表空间,数据文件位于 /u01/oradata/dbname/users01.dbf
,初始大小为100MB,并且配置为当空间不足时自动扩展每次10MB,无最大尺寸限制。同时,它使用日志模式。
评论已关闭